Size: a a a

2020 December 25

ИК

Илья Китов in Airflow
Sergey Gavrilov
Вы не смогли найти, потому что с такой формулировкой не очень понятно, что надо делать. Просто делать бэкап-рестор, выгрузку в файл, всё в памяти? Всю таблицу разам, по частям, как делить?
Таблица большая или маленькая? Если большая, то без ответа на вышеидущие вопросы ничего у вас не выйдет, если маленькая, то в чём проблема? И т.д.
не усложняйте)

Я пытаюсь найти самый простой пример Дага, который к примеру из таблицы в Oracle переносит данную в идентичную таблицу Oracle, записей мало, просто пару строк. Просто для примера, так как в airflow только вникаю. Не обязательно оракл, не обязательно один в один, просто понять как это работает, желательно с трансформацией какой-то, прям чтобы ETL был
источник

IK

Ivan Kizimenko in Airflow
Илья Китов
не усложняйте)

Я пытаюсь найти самый простой пример Дага, который к примеру из таблицы в Oracle переносит данную в идентичную таблицу Oracle, записей мало, просто пару строк. Просто для примера, так как в airflow только вникаю. Не обязательно оракл, не обязательно один в один, просто понять как это работает, желательно с трансформацией какой-то, прям чтобы ETL был
источник

M

Mikhail in Airflow
Илья Китов
не усложняйте)

Я пытаюсь найти самый простой пример Дага, который к примеру из таблицы в Oracle переносит данную в идентичную таблицу Oracle, записей мало, просто пару строк. Просто для примера, так как в airflow только вникаю. Не обязательно оракл, не обязательно один в один, просто понять как это работает, желательно с трансформацией какой-то, прям чтобы ETL был
а репликации таблиц нету в оракле?
источник

SG

Sergey Gavrilov in Airflow
Илья Китов
не усложняйте)

Я пытаюсь найти самый простой пример Дага, который к примеру из таблицы в Oracle переносит данную в идентичную таблицу Oracle, записей мало, просто пару строк. Просто для примера, так как в airflow только вникаю. Не обязательно оракл, не обязательно один в один, просто понять как это работает, желательно с трансформацией какой-то, прям чтобы ETL был
Ну тогда это просто oracleoperator с селектом о_О
источник

ИК

Илья Китов in Airflow
Mikhail
а репликации таблиц нету в оракле?
Ну есть конечно, Я же как пример указал, чтобы глянуть как Даг работает, конкретно такой задачи не стоит) можно поменять на пример из оракл в постргре, главное из базы в базу)
источник

IK

Ivan Kizimenko in Airflow
если базы на разных машинах, то слил данные во временное хранилище/файл, потом залил в нужную
источник

ИК

Илья Китов in Airflow
Ivan Kizimenko
если базы на разных машинах, то слил данные во временное хранилище/файл, потом залил в нужную
А в памяти он не хранит?
источник

VS

Vladislav 👻 Shishkov... in Airflow
читаешь батчем, пишешь батчем
источник

IK

Ivan Kizimenko in Airflow
хранит это если в рамках одного таска, если между тасками то надо Xcom, а там есть лимит на объем
источник

ИК

Илья Китов in Airflow
О как, теперь вся мазайка сложилась
источник

ИК

Илья Китов in Airflow
Я не правильно интерпритировал для себя этот инструмент
источник

IK

Ivan Kizimenko in Airflow
если задача простая то можешь сделать тупо 1 таск который и вытащит и положит в другую бд =)
источник

ИК

Илья Китов in Airflow
Ну да, проще тогда так и делать
источник

ИК

Илья Китов in Airflow
Это же можно тогда python оператором просто прописать
источник

IK

Ivan Kizimenko in Airflow
да
источник

ИК

Илья Китов in Airflow
А вот эти экзамплы по умолчанию с ним идут? А то я какой то image скачал, где примеров не было
источник

YT

Yury Trostin in Airflow
всем привет
я тут в UI сервера эирфлоу обнаружил очень давно висящие Jobs
источник

YT

Yury Trostin in Airflow
вопрос: влияет ли это на что-то и если да, то как их убить ?
источник

IK

Ivan Kizimenko in Airflow
ну это же по сути запись в бд просто, надо наверно по логам посмотреть чтоб там ничего лишнего
источник

SZ

Sergey Zhuravlev in Airflow
Илья Китов
А вот эти экзамплы по умолчанию с ним идут? А то я какой то image скачал, где примеров не было
Если ставить в venv по офф инструкции то они стоят по умолчанию. Если сторонний докер образ то может и не быть
источник